There are over 50 mountain bike trails around Armadale, offering a wide range of options for different skill levels and preferences.
Armadale's mountain biking terrain is diverse, featuring lush forests, rugged hillsides, and picturesque valleys. You'll find everything from gentle loops to more technical singletracks, providing a varied and immersive outdoor experience.
Yes, Armadale offers many easy trails perfect for beginners. For example, the Picnic Area at Hillend Loch – Caldercruix Cycleway loop from Bathgate is an easy 19.9-mile path that follows a scenic cycleway alongside a loch. Another accessible option is the Camps Viaduct loop from Bathgate, which is 18.6 miles long and leads through varied terrain.
The ideal time for mountain biking in Armadale is during the cooler months of autumn and spring. Mild temperatures and minimal rainfall during these seasons create pleasant riding conditions, making for a more enjoyable experience on the trails.
While many trails cater to easier and moderate levels, the region offers options for more experienced riders. The Black Law Windfarm loop from Whitburn is a moderate 25.5-mile trail with expansive views, providing a good challenge. For those seeking purpose-built facilities, Champion Lakes Bike Park, just outside Armadale, features pump tracks, dirt jumps, and technical elements.
The mountain bike trails in Armadale are highly rated by the komoot community, with an average score of 4.1 stars from over 40 reviews. Riders often praise the diverse trails, lush forests, and rugged hillsides that define the region's cycling experience.
Yes, Armadale's trails often wind through picturesque valleys and natural settings, offering breathtaking views. You can also find notable natural features nearby, such as the Cockleroy Hill Summit, which provides excellent panoramic views, and the Union Canal, offering tranquil waterside scenery.
Absolutely. The area around Armadale is rich in history. You might encounter the impressive Avon Aqueduct, a significant engineering marvel. Further afield, you can explore historic sites like Callendar House and Linlithgow Palace, both offering a glimpse into the region's past.
Many of the mountain bike routes in Armadale are designed as loops, allowing you to start and finish at the same point. Examples include the Black Law Windfarm loop from Whitburn and the National Cycle Route 75 Path – Caldercruix Cycleway loop from Armadale.
Trail lengths in Armadale vary, but many popular routes range from approximately 18 to 25 miles. For instance, the Path to the Meadow Pyramids – Dechmont Law Summit loop from Bathgate is about 13.6 miles (21.9 km), while the National Cycle Route 75 Path – Caldercruix Cycleway loop from Armadale is around 19.2 miles (30.9 km).
